    I see doughnuts part for stallion, what are those ? were they event specific ?
    When you are building a bike that needs them... they will appear. In the chip shop, as season rewards in Bunker, occasionally as rewards on the Loot Wheel, etc. You can buy them for gems in the garage.... propsector used to give them out daily but they took him away (arrgh!) and replaced him with the Puppy that doesnt give... anything worthwhile....

    HInt: if you have built one bike that needs them but know you'll be building another bike that needs them... DONT finish your first bike. Leave one slot unupgraded. That way the donuts will stick around, and you can keep stashing away donuts until you need them for the second bike. Because once you dont need them... they disappear.
